VirtualBox 202610 周效率实践清单:深度排查启动黑屏与网络桥接失效

技术文章
VirtualBox 202610 周效率实践清单:深度排查启动黑屏与网络桥接失效

本指南针对 VirtualBox 202610 周期内用户反馈的高频故障,整理出一套实战化的周效率提升清单。重点解决虚拟机启动卡死、内核驱动签名冲突以及复杂的网络桥接失效问题。通过对 VBoxManage 命令行工具的深度调用与注册表底层参数的修正,帮助运维人员与开发者在遇到环境崩溃时,能够快速定位 0x80004005 等典型错误代码,实现从环境异常到恢复默认的高效闭环,确保虚拟化开发环境的长期稳定运行。

在虚拟化环境的日常维护中,效率往往被琐碎的配置报错所吞噬。本清单聚焦于 VirtualBox 202610 节点下的核心故障场景,拒绝空泛的理论,直击底层驱动与参数配置冲突。

内核驱动冲突:解决 0x80004005 启动中断

许多用户在更新系统补丁后,启动 VirtualBox 会遭遇严重的 0x80004005 错误。这通常并非镜像损坏,而是 VBoxDrv.inf 驱动未能正确注册或被系统驱动强制覆盖。在 202610 周实践中,我们建议放弃重装软件的低效方案,直接进入 C:\Program Files\Oracle\VirtualBox\drivers\vboxdrv 目录,右键点击 VBoxDrv.inf 选择安装。随后以管理员权限执行 'sc start vboxdrv'。若返回错误码 577,说明数字签名校验受限,此时需检查 Windows Integrity Checks 设置。通过这种底层驱动重置法,可将原本需要 1 小时的重装流程缩短至 3 分钟,是恢复默认运行环境的首选路径。

VirtualBox相关配图

显卡加速异常:VMSVGA 模式下的黑屏排查

随着 VirtualBox 7.x 分支的普及,图形控制器的选择变得至关重要。若你在 202610 实践周中遇到启动后仅有光标闪烁或全黑屏,请立即检查‘设置-显示’选项。对于 Linux 客户机,强制将图形控制器更改为 VMSVGA 并禁用 3D 加速是快速恢复访问的有效手段。一个容易被忽视的细节是显存分配:默认的 16MB 往往不足以支撑现代 GUI,建议手动调整至 128MB 以上。若依然无法进入系统,可尝试使用 VBoxManage modifyvm "VM Name" --graphicscontroller vmsvga 指令进行强制覆盖,这能绕过 GUI 界面因配置冲突导致的保存失效问题。

VirtualBox相关配图

网络桥接失效:NDIS6 过滤驱动的精准修复

当虚拟机显示‘未指定网络’或桥接网卡列表为空时,问题多出在宿主机的 NDIS6 过滤驱动上。在 202610 版本的环境排查中,我们发现多网卡环境下(如同时开启 Wi-Fi 与以太网)容易出现绑定冲突。实操细节:进入宿主机网卡属性,取消勾选 'VirtualBox NDIS6 Bridged Networking Driver',点击确定后再重新勾选。若无效,需通过 VBoxManage list bridgedifs 查看网卡唯一标识符。针对特定版本中出现的 DHCP 分配失败,手动指定虚拟机网卡的混杂模式(Promiscuous Mode)为 'Allow All',通常能解决 90% 以上的局域网互通异常,避免了频繁重启宿主机的无效操作。

VirtualBox相关配图

效率进阶:利用 Headless 模式与快照链管理

高效的实践清单离不开对资源的极致利用。在处理多任务实验时,频繁打开 GUI 界面会消耗大量宿主机内存。建议熟练使用无界面模式启动:'VBoxManage startvm "VM Name" --type headless'。此外,针对故障排查中的‘实验性修改’,必须建立严谨的快照链。当遇到设置异常无法回退时,通过 VBoxManage snapshot "VM Name" restorelast 指令可实现秒级回滚。在 202610 周期内,我们强调‘先快照后排错’的原则,这不仅是防止数据丢失的底线,更是提升故障恢复效率的核心逻辑。

常见问题

虚拟机提示‘Raw-mode is unavailable courtesy of Hyper-V’如何不关闭系统功能解决?

这是典型的虚拟化嵌套冲突。在不关闭 Windows Hyper-V 功能的前提下,尝试执行 VBoxManage modifyvm "VM Name" --hwvirtex off,虽然会损失部分性能,但能解决因内核抢占导致的虚拟机无法启动问题。

为什么修改了 .vbox 配置文件后,重新打开软件设置又被还原了?

VirtualBox 在运行时会锁定配置文件。必须先完全退出 VirtualBox 进程(包括后台服务),再编辑 XML 文件。最稳妥的方法是使用 VBoxManage 命令行工具修改,它会自动处理配置文件的同步与锁定机制。

如何快速清理已删除虚拟机残留的虚拟磁盘占用?

仅在界面删除虚拟机往往无法释放物理磁盘。请前往‘管理-虚拟介质管理器’,找到状态为‘未附加’的 VDI 文件,执行释放并删除操作。或者使用 VBoxManage closemedium disk --delete 指令彻底销毁残留文件。

总结

获取更多 VirtualBox 202610 深度优化工具包与排障脚本,请访问官方技术支持频道。

相关阅读:VirtualBox 202610 周效率实践清单VirtualBox 202610 周效率实践清单使用技巧VirtualBox中文版设置全攻略:深度修复语言失效与虚拟机启动报错

VirtualBox 202610 周效率实践清单 VirtualBox

快速下载

下载 VirtualBox